Output 59d8c63b3f215889e7a79fb9ba3432f88ea207ff6981fc143269737228ae391d:23

value
1000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 17fd1aacdaaa4d5da0063587f3bfce8126607e02836595edeb64424ffe6fb8c2
address
tb1pzl734tx64fx4mgqxxkrl807wsynxqlszsdjetm0tv3pylln0hrpqvr7saq
transaction
59d8c63b3f215889e7a79fb9ba3432f88ea207ff6981fc143269737228ae391d
confirmations
89881
spent
false